Colorado City man given probation in plea deal

A Colorado City man was given a probated sentence during a hearing in District Judge Ernie B. Armstrong’s courtroom recently. Damonte Terrell Bryant, 26, was given a five-year probated sentence after he entered a plea agreement on a third degree felony charge of claiming a lottery prize by fraud.
